Nodes: move NodeTreeRef functionality into node runtime data
The purpose of `NodeTreeRef` was to speed up various queries on a read-only `bNodeTree`. Not that we have runtime data in nodes and sockets, we can also store the result of some queries there. This has some benefits: * No need for a read-only separate node tree data structure which increased complexity. * Makes it easier to reuse cached queries in more parts of Blender that can benefit from it. A downside is that we loose some type safety that we got by having different types for input and output sockets, as well as internal and non-internal links. This patch also refactors `DerivedNodeTree` so that it does not use `NodeTreeRef` anymore, but uses `bNodeTree` directly instead. To provide a convenient API (that is also close to what `NodeTreeRef` has), a new approach is implemented: `bNodeTree`, `bNode`, `bNodeSocket` and `bNodeLink` now have C++ methods declared in `DNA_node_types.h` which are implemented in `BKE_node_runtime.hh`. To make this work, `makesdna` now skips c++ sections when parsing dna header files. No user visible changes are expected. Differential Revision: https://developer.blender.org/D15491
